自定义博客皮肤VIP专享

*博客头图:

格式为PNG、JPG,宽度*高度大于1920*100像素,不超过2MB,主视觉建议放在右侧,请参照线上博客头图

请上传大于1920*100像素的图片!

博客底图:

图片格式为PNG、JPG,不超过1MB,可上下左右平铺至整个背景

栏目图:

图片格式为PNG、JPG,图片宽度*高度为300*38像素,不超过0.5MB

主标题颜色:

RGB颜色,例如:#AFAFAF

Hover:

RGB颜色,例如:#AFAFAF

副标题颜色:

RGB颜色,例如:#AFAFAF

自定义博客皮肤

-+
  • 博客(13)
  • 收藏
  • 关注

原创 TCP UDP

UDP使用 udp 发送/接收数据步骤:1.创建客户端套接字2.发送/接收数据3.关闭套接字1.import socket2.def main():3. # 1、创建 udp 套接字4. # socket.AF_INET 表示 IPv4 协议 AF_INET6 表示 IPv6 协议5. # socket.SOCK_DGRAM 数据报套接字,只要用于 udp 协议6. u...

2018-12-17 21:33:48 200

原创 并发 并行

并行:同一时刻多个任务同时在运行。并发:在同一时间间隔内多个任务都在运行,但是并不会在同一时刻同时运行,存在交替执行的情况。线程是并发,进程是并行;进程之间相互独立,是系统分配资源的最小单位,同一个线程中的所有线程共享资源。实现并行的库有:multiprocessing实现并发的库有:threading...

2018-12-17 21:10:24 171

原创 浅谈线程、进程

进程:一个运行的程序(代码)就是一个进程,没有运行的代码叫程序,进程是系统资源分配的最小单位,进程拥有自己独立的内存空间,所以进程间数据不共享,开销大。线程: 是资源调度执行的最小单位,不能独立存在,依赖进程存在一个进程至少有一个线程,叫主线程,而多个线程共享内存(数据共享,共享全局变量),从而极大地提高了程序的运行效率。python中的多线程是伪多线程协程:是一种用户态的轻量级线程,是一种特...

2018-12-17 20:46:28 346

原创 生成器 迭代器 装饰器

迭代器迭代器表面上看是一个数据流对象或者容器,当使用其中的数据时,每次从数据流中取出一个数据,直到数据被取完,而且数据不会被重复使用。从代码的角度来看,迭代器是实现了迭代器协议方法的对象和类。迭代器协议方法主要是两个:iter()#该方法返回对象本身,它是for语句使用迭代器的要求next()#方法用于返回容器中下一个元素或者数据。当容器中的数据用尽时,应该引发StopIteration异常...

2018-12-17 20:12:32 1190

原创 linux的一些基本命令

常用指令ls   显示文件或目录 -l 列出文件详细信息l(list) -a 列出当前目录下所有文件及目录,包括隐藏的a(all)mkdir 创建目录 -p 创建目录,若无父目录,则创建p(parent)cd 切换目录touch 创建空文件ec...

2018-12-16 18:50:25 144

原创 python中常用的git

git clone 地址 克隆地址git branch 查看分支git checkout -b dev origin/dev 克隆服务器的dev分支git checkout -b [name] 创建自己的分支git status 查看状态git add . 添加git commit -m “内容” 保存git push origin [name] ...

2018-12-16 18:36:55 211

原创 python中事务

python中的事务为什么要有事务事务广泛的运用于订单系统、银行系统等多种场景例如:A用户和B用户是银行的储户,现在A要给B转账500元,那么需要做以下几件事:检查A的账户余额>500元;A 账户中扣除500元;B 账户中增加500元;正常的流程走下来,A账户扣了500,B账户加了500,皆大欢喜。那如果A账户扣了钱之后,系统出故障了呢?A白白损失了500,而B也没...

2018-12-16 10:51:45 360

原创 Django项目基本框架实现

2018-12-10 23:32:34 217

原创 python中Docker使用

FastDFStracker:管理可用的存储服务器storage:存储文件说明:strorage会生成唯一标识,作为文件的名称,并返回Docker在开发阶段使用的环境,可以方便的在服务器布署出来镜像image=========>文件的存储形式容器container=======>运行软件需要运行镜像,运行镜像后得到容器FastDFS的组成部分及上传图片的流程track...

2018-12-04 18:03:57 728

原创 python中的数据库

MySQL关系型数据库mysql -uroot -p密码 进入数据库exit 退出数据库selece version() 查看版本select now() 显示当前时间show databases; 查看所有数据库select databases(); 查看当前数据库use...

2018-12-04 17:40:10 198

原创 常见列表 、字典操作

列表1 增加列表.append(数据) 在末尾追加数据,并且每次只能添加一个列表.extend([4,5,6,7,8]) 可迭代列表.insert(索引, 数据) 在指定位置插入数据(位置前有空元素会补位)2 删除 del 列表[索引] 删除指定索引的数据列表.remove(数据) 删除第一个出现的指定数据列表.pop() 删除列表中的最后一个元素列表...

2018-12-03 19:22:15 169

原创 DRF

定义序列化器 作用:进行序列化、反序列化操作 序列化:将对象转字典 反序列化:将字典进行验证后,再转对象 class ***Serializer(serializers.Serializer): 根据模型类定义属性 属性=serializers.类型(约束) read_only=只读,只用于输出 write_only=只写,只用于输入 required=必须序列...

2018-12-03 00:00:04 444 1

原创 Python中Django小结01

python manage.py startapp 应用名称子级中 url(正则表达式,视图函数名称)根级中 url(正则表达式,include(‘应用名称.urls’)cookie 存储在浏览器中session 存储在服务器中session必须依赖于cookie根级:url(正则表达式,include(‘应用.urls’))子级:url(正则表达式,函数名称或类名.as_view(...

2018-12-01 20:44:57 118

空空如也

空空如也

TA创建的收藏夹 TA关注的收藏夹

TA关注的人

提示
确定要删除当前文章?
取消 删除